I also attended several classes, including “Understanding the Value of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) within the Scheduling/Dispatching Function”. This class covered creating SOP's and using risk analysis within your SMS program. We also overviewed the FAA and ICAO requirements of a SMS and covered the four pillars of Safety Policy, Safety Risk Management, Safety Assurance, Safety Promotion.
